The Burning Question: Understanding Firewood Costs in Today’s Market

The firewood industry is dynamic, influenced by factors ranging from local weather patterns to global economic trends. As of late 2024, the average cost of a cord of seasoned firewood delivered in the United States hovers around $250 – $450, but this varies dramatically. For instance, in densely populated areas with high demand, prices can easily exceed $500 per cord. Conversely, in rural regions with ample wood supply, you might find prices closer to $200.

Current Market Statistics:

  • Price per Cord: Averages $250-$450 (USD) nationally, fluctuating based on location and wood type.
  • Delivery Fees: Typically range from $50-$100, depending on distance and the supplier.
  • Wood Type Impact: Hardwoods like oak and maple command higher prices due to their density and heat output.
  • Seasoning Premium: Seasoned firewood is often 20-50% more expensive than green wood.
  • Demand Peaks: Winter months see a surge in demand, driving prices upwards.

These figures highlight the importance of being resourceful and strategic in your firewood procurement. Understanding these market dynamics is the first step in effectively managing your heating costs.

Hack #1: Buy Green Wood and Season It Yourself

This is where the real savings begin. Purchasing green wood – freshly cut, unseasoned wood – is significantly cheaper than buying seasoned firewood. You’re essentially paying for the time and effort the supplier would have invested in drying the wood.

The Science of Seasoning:

Seasoning firewood involves reducing its moisture content, ideally below 20%. Green wood can have a moisture content of 50% or higher. As the wood dries, it becomes easier to ignite, burns cleaner and hotter, and produces less smoke.

Step-by-Step Guide to Seasoning Firewood:

  1. Choose Your Wood: Opt for hardwoods like oak, maple, ash, or beech. These species offer excellent heat output and long burn times. Softwoods like pine and fir can be used, but they burn faster and produce more creosote. I once made the mistake of relying too heavily on pine during a particularly harsh winter. The frequent chimney cleanings were a constant reminder of my misjudgment.
  2. Splitting: Split the wood into manageable pieces. Smaller pieces dry faster. I recommend using a good maul or hydraulic splitter, depending on the volume of wood you plan to process.
  3. Stacking: Stack the wood in a single row, elevated off the ground on pallets or rails. This promotes airflow. Leave space between the rows for further ventilation. Orient the stacks to maximize sun exposure and wind flow.
  4. Location, Location, Location: Choose a sunny, well-ventilated location for your woodpile. Avoid stacking wood against buildings or under trees, as this can trap moisture.
  5. Covering (Optional): While covering the top of the woodpile can protect it from rain and snow, it’s crucial to leave the sides open for ventilation. I prefer to leave my stacks uncovered, allowing them to dry naturally.
  6. Patience is a Virtue: Seasoning takes time. Hardwoods typically require 6-12 months of drying, while softwoods may dry in 3-6 months. Use a moisture meter to check the wood’s moisture content before burning.

Data Point: Properly seasoned firewood burns approximately 20-30% more efficiently than green wood.

Cost Savings: Buying green wood can save you 30-50% compared to purchasing seasoned firewood.

Troubleshooting:

  • Mold Growth: If you notice mold, improve ventilation and ensure the wood is exposed to sunlight.
  • Slow Drying: Check your stacking method and location. Ensure adequate airflow and sun exposure.

Hack #2: Negotiate with Local Suppliers

Building relationships with local firewood suppliers can yield significant savings. Don’t be afraid to negotiate, especially if you’re buying in bulk or during the off-season.

Negotiation Strategies:

  1. Shop Around: Get quotes from multiple suppliers to compare prices.
  2. Bulk Discounts: Inquire about discounts for purchasing larger quantities.
  3. Off-Season Deals: Buy firewood in the spring or summer when demand is lower.
  4. Cash Discounts: Some suppliers offer discounts for cash payments.
  5. Delivery Flexibility: Offer to be flexible with delivery times to accommodate the supplier’s schedule.
  6. Bartering: Offer a service or trade in exchange for firewood. I once helped a local supplier repair his chainsaw in exchange for a load of firewood.

Real Example: I know a neighbor who consistently secures a 10% discount by helping the local firewood supplier stack wood during his busy season.

Key Tip: Be polite and respectful during negotiations. Building a positive relationship can lead to long-term savings.

Hack #4: Invest in Efficient Wood-Burning Technology

The efficiency of your wood-burning appliance can significantly impact the amount of firewood you need. Investing in a high-efficiency stove or fireplace insert can reduce your firewood consumption by 20-50%.

Types of Efficient Wood-Burning Appliances:

  1. EPA-Certified Stoves: These stoves are designed to burn cleaner and more efficiently than older models. They meet strict emissions standards set by the Environmental Protection Agency (EPA).
  2. Fireplace Inserts: These inserts are designed to fit into existing fireplaces, improving their efficiency and reducing heat loss.
  3. Masonry Heaters: These heaters are designed to store heat and release it slowly over time. They are highly efficient and can provide long-lasting warmth.
  4. Pellet Stoves: While not technically firewood, pellet stoves burn wood pellets, which are a renewable and efficient fuel source.

Data Point: EPA-certified stoves can burn up to 50% less wood than older, non-certified models.

Cost-Benefit Analysis:

While the initial investment in an efficient wood-burning appliance may seem high, the long-term savings on firewood can quickly offset the cost. Calculate your annual firewood consumption and the potential savings from a more efficient appliance to determine the payback period.

My Experience: I upgraded to an EPA-certified wood stove several years ago, and I’ve been amazed by the difference. I use significantly less firewood, and my home is much warmer and more comfortable.

Hack #5: Master Firewood Preparation Techniques

Proper firewood preparation is essential for efficient burning. This includes splitting wood to the right size, stacking it properly, and using the right kindling and fire starters.

Firewood Preparation Techniques:

  1. Splitting: Split wood into pieces that are approximately 4-6 inches in diameter. Smaller pieces ignite more easily and burn faster, while larger pieces burn longer.
  2. Stacking: Stack firewood in a single row, elevated off the ground on pallets or rails. Leave space between the rows for ventilation.
  3. Kindling: Use dry, small pieces of wood or twigs to start your fire. Avoid using paper, as it can produce excessive smoke. I often use birch bark, which is a natural and effective fire starter.
  4. Fire Starters: Consider using natural fire starters, such as pine cones dipped in wax or cotton balls soaked in petroleum jelly. Avoid using flammable liquids, as they can be dangerous.
  5. Top-Down Burning: Try using a top-down burning method. This involves placing larger pieces of wood on the bottom of the firebox and smaller pieces of kindling on top. This method promotes cleaner and more efficient burning.

Data Point: Properly split and stacked firewood can burn up to 20% more efficiently.

Common Pitfalls:

  • Burning Wet Wood: Burning wet wood produces excessive smoke and creosote, which can be dangerous.
  • Overloading the Firebox: Overloading the firebox can restrict airflow and reduce efficiency.
  • Using the Wrong Kind of Wood: Avoid burning treated wood, painted wood, or wood that has been exposed to chemicals.

The Right Tools for the Job: Chainsaws, Axes, and More

Choosing the right tools can make firewood preparation easier, safer, and more efficient. Here’s a breakdown of essential tools:

Chainsaws

Chainsaws are indispensable for felling trees and bucking logs.

  • Types: Gas-powered, electric, and battery-powered.
  • Gas-Powered: Offer the most power and runtime, ideal for heavy-duty tasks. I’ve always preferred gas-powered saws for their reliability and raw power when dealing with larger trees.
  • Electric: Quieter and easier to maintain, suitable for smaller jobs and homeowners.
  • Battery-Powered: Offer a good balance of power and convenience, but runtime can be limited.
  • Key Considerations: Bar length, engine size, safety features (chain brake, anti-vibration), weight, and ease of maintenance.
  • Safety Gear: Always wear a helmet with face shield, ear protection, gloves, and chaps.

Axes and Mauls

Axes and mauls are essential for splitting firewood.

  • Axes: Designed for felling trees and limbing.
  • Mauls: Designed for splitting logs.
  • Types: Splitting mauls, splitting axes, and felling axes.
  • Key Considerations: Weight, handle length, head design, and steel quality.
  • Proper Technique: Use a chopping block, maintain a wide stance, and swing with your whole body.
  • Safety: Wear safety glasses and gloves.

Hydraulic Log Splitters

Hydraulic log splitters are a great option for splitting large volumes of firewood.

  • Types: Gas-powered and electric.
  • Gas-Powered: Offer more power and portability.
  • Electric: Quieter and require less maintenance.
  • Key Considerations: Tonnage, cycle time, log capacity, and portability.
  • Safety: Wear safety glasses and gloves.

Hand Tools

A variety of hand tools can be useful for firewood preparation.

  • Wedges: Used to split logs that are difficult to split with an axe or maul.
  • Sledgehammers: Used to drive wedges into logs.
  • Peavies and Cant Hooks: Used to roll and position logs.
  • Measuring Tools: Used to measure firewood for stacking and selling.

Tool Maintenance:

  • Chainsaws: Sharpen the chain regularly, clean the air filter, and check the fuel and oil levels.
  • Axes and Mauls: Sharpen the blade regularly and keep the handle clean and dry.
  • Hydraulic Log Splitters: Check the fluid levels and lubricate moving parts.

Wood Species: Choosing the Right Wood for Your Needs

Different wood species have different properties that affect their suitability for firewood.

Hardwoods vs. Softwoods:

  • Hardwoods: Dense, burn longer, and produce more heat. Examples: Oak, maple, ash, beech, and hickory.
  • Softwoods: Less dense, burn faster, and produce less heat. Examples: Pine, fir, spruce, and cedar.

Key Wood Species and Their Properties:

  • Oak: Excellent heat output, long burn time, and low smoke production. A top choice for firewood.
  • Maple: Good heat output, moderate burn time, and moderate smoke production. A great all-around firewood.
  • Ash: Excellent heat output, long burn time, and low smoke production. Easy to split.
  • Beech: Excellent heat output, long burn time, and low smoke production. Can be difficult to split.
  • Hickory: Excellent heat output, long burn time, and low smoke production. Often used for smoking meat.
  • Pine: Moderate heat output, short burn time, and high smoke production. Best used for kindling.
  • Fir: Moderate heat output, short burn time, and moderate smoke production.
  • Spruce: Low heat output, short burn time, and high smoke production.
  • Cedar: Low heat output, short burn time, and high smoke production. Aromatic and often used for kindling.

Data Point: Oak has approximately 20% more BTU (British Thermal Units) per cord than pine.

Choosing the Right Wood:

  • Consider your heating needs, budget, and the availability of different wood species in your area.
  • Hardwoods are generally the best choice for primary heating, while softwoods can be used for kindling or supplemental heat.

Stacking Firewood for Optimal Drying: The Art and Science

Proper stacking is crucial for efficient drying. Here’s a detailed guide:

Stacking Methods:

  • Single Row Stacking: The most common method, where wood is stacked in a single row, elevated off the ground.
  • Circular Stacking: Wood is stacked in a circular pattern around a central pole. This method promotes good airflow.
  • Holz Hausen: A traditional German method where wood is stacked in a circular, beehive-shaped structure. This method is aesthetically pleasing and promotes excellent drying.

Key Stacking Principles:

  1. Elevation: Elevate the wood off the ground on pallets, rails, or rocks to prevent moisture absorption and promote airflow.
  2. Ventilation: Leave space between the rows and between the pieces of wood to allow air to circulate.
  3. Sun Exposure: Orient the stacks to maximize sun exposure.
  4. Covering (Optional): Cover the top of the woodpile to protect it from rain and snow, but leave the sides open for ventilation.

My Preferred Method: I prefer single-row stacking with pallets for elevation. It’s simple, efficient, and allows for good airflow.

Case Study: I once experimented with different stacking methods and found that single-row stacking on pallets resulted in the fastest drying time.

Troubleshooting Common Firewood Problems

Even with the best preparation, you may encounter problems. Here are some common issues and solutions:

  • Wet Firewood: If your firewood is wet, try drying it indoors for a few days before burning it. You can also try using a fire starter to help it ignite.
  • Smoky Fire: A smoky fire is often caused by burning wet wood or using the wrong kind of wood. Make sure your firewood is dry and that you’re using hardwoods.
  • Creosote Buildup: Creosote is a flammable substance that can build up in your chimney. Have your chimney inspected and cleaned regularly to prevent creosote buildup.
  • Difficulty Splitting Wood: If you’re having difficulty splitting wood, try using a wedge or a hydraulic log splitter.

Prevention is Key:

  • Season your firewood properly to prevent it from getting wet.
  • Use the right kind of wood for your needs.
  • Have your chimney inspected and cleaned regularly.
